Product overview
Description
The X-CUBE-IPS expansion software package for STM32Cube runs on the STM32 and includes drivers that control the industrial intelligent power switches (IPS) mounted on several expansion boards.
This software allows controlling the output channels of the expansion boards when connected to a NUCLEO-F401RE or NUCLEO-G431RB development board.
It is possible to build systems with multiple boards stacked to evaluate multichannel digital output modules, even with different output current capabilities.
Each output channel can be switched into the steady-state mode or PWM mode.
In the PWM mode, the software allows you to program the expansion boards to be switched on and off using a specific frequency and duty cycle.
The software included in the package can be used in three integrated development environments (IDEs): IAR, Keil®, and STM32CubeIDE.
The expansion boards supported are the following:
- X-NUCLEO-OUT01A2, 8-ch galvanic isolated high-side digital output based on ISO8200BQ
- X-NUCLEO-OUT03A1, 2-ch high-side digital output based on IPS2050H
- X-NUCLEO-OUT04A1, 2-ch high-side digital output based on IPS2050H-32
- X-NUCLEO-OUT05A1, 1-ch high-side digital output based on IPS1025H
- X-NUCLEO-OUT06A1, 1-ch high-side digital output based on IPS1025H-32
- X-NUCLEO-OUT07A1, 4-ch low-side digital output based on IPS4260L
- X-NUCLEO-OUT08A1, 1-ch high-side digital output based on IPS160HF
- X-NUCLEO-OUT09A1, 8-ch high-side digital output based on IPS8160HQ
- X-NUCLEO-OUT10A1, 1-ch high-side digital output based on IPS161HF
- X-NUCLEO-OUT11A1, 8-ch galvanic isolated high-side digital output based on ISO808
- X-NUCLEO-OUT12A1, 8-ch galvanic isolated high-side digital output with SPI interface based on ISO808A
- X-NUCLEO-OUT13A1, 8-ch galvanic isolated high-side digital output based on ISO808-1
- X-NUCLEO-OUT14A1, 8-ch galvanic isolated high-side digital output with SPI interface based on ISO808A-1
- X-NUCLEO-OUT15A1, 1-ch high-side digital output based on IPS1025HF
- X-NUCLEO-OUT16A1, 8-ch high-side digital output with parallel and SPI (8/16-bit) interface based on IPS8200HQ
- X-NUCLEO-OUT17A1, 8-ch high-side digital output with parallel and SPI (8/16-bit) interface based on IPS8200HQ-1
- X-NUCLEO-OUT19A1, 8-ch high-side digital output based on IPS8160HQ-1
-
All features
- Software package to build applications using the expansion boards that mount the industrial intelligent power switches (IPS)
- Includes ready-to-use firmware to evaluate easily the driving and diagnostic capabilities of the IPS products for industrial loads
- Support for NUCLEO-F401RE and NUCLEO-G431RB development boards
- GPIOs, PWMs, and IRQs
- Fault/diagnostics interrupt handling
- Compatible with STM32CubeMX, can be downloaded from st.com and installed directly into STM32CubeMX
- Easy portability across different MCU families, thanks to STM32Cube
- Free, user-friendly license terms